Meghan Markle’s Estranged Best Friend Absent in Harry and Meghan Docuseries

The highly publicized love story of and has been brought to life in the docuseries Harry and Meghan, with the help of the Royal Inner Circle.

The couple introduced a number of celebrity pals, former colleagues, and childhood friends, but one person who was noticeably absent was Meghan's estranged best friend, Jessica Mulroney.

Although Jessica has yet to make an appearance in the series, Meghan did refer to her close friend in a touching moment.

Just before proposed to Meghan in the walled garden of Kensington Palace, the former Suits star appeared to have video called Jessica Mulroney.

Meghan could be heard saying, “Oh my god Jess, it's happening, he told me not to peek.”

Jessica and Meghan reportedly had a falling out in 2020 when influencer Sasha Exeter called out Jessica for displaying textbook white privilege within the fashion blogging community.

When Jessica apologized, citing Meghan as one of her closest friends, Markle reportedly put an end to their friendship.

Many people are hoping that Jessica Mulroney will write a tell-all book about her relationship with Meghan.
